Assuming the first part of the statement as p, second as q and the third as r, the statement 'Candidates are present, and voters are ready to vote but no ballot papers' in symbolic form is

A

`( p vv q) ^^ ~r`

B

`(p ^^ ~q) ^^ r`

C

`(~ p ^^ q) ^^ ~r`

D

`(p ^^ q) ^^ ~r`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
D
